Papy Djilobodji insists he has no regrets over his time with Chelsea.
The defender is currently on-loan at Dijon from Sunderland, having never managed an appearance with Chelsea.
He told L'Equipe: "I learned a lot of things.
"I trained with great players. I learned what the soccer world really is, that it was necessary to be 100% every day, to do always more in the training.
"I wanted to show more, I did not have a chance (with José Mourinho, then Guus Hiddink), but I never gave up. I left for Bremen on January 21, 2016, and I benefited from the Bundesliga by participating in the permanence of the Werder (14 matches)."
